Description: Gnomescroll is an open-source, community-developed role-playing game and game engine. It features procedurally generated open worlds and content, customizable characters, magic spells, quests, and more in a fantasy setting.

Description: MineDroid is a free and open-source game for Android that allows you to experience Minecraft gameplay on mobile. It features infinite procedural world generation, resource gathering, crafting, and survival mechanics similar to Minecraft.
